Merry Clayton's intense vocal was integral to the tremendous power of the original recording, but I remember seeing footage of her performing live, and feeling that she did not project herself as strongly as her voice alone would suggest. I wondered if this might have kept her from achieving the success she clearly wanted and felt she deserved? Lisa Fischer has an explosive stage presence that can go toe to toe with Mick. Although he is rightly recognised as one of the best frontmen in the history of rock'n'roll, it's the whole package that won him his reputation rather than the quality of his voice _per se_. He's not Celine Dion, but that's not the point. Lisa Fischer deivers the goods vocally, and in a way that complements Jagger very effectively, but whether she could or would want to keep it up for 2 or 3 hours a show over the course of 50 years is another matter. Singing like a goddess is one thing, but being Mick Jagger is a lot of work. This song on its own is a tough assignment for any singer, and Merry Clayton casts a long, almost regal shadow. The expectation of audiences, together with the urgency of the message makes it easy to oversing, as some of the ladies heard here demonstrate I think. Mick did not set so high a bar for himself. It's not as if he phones it in, but the part of Mick Jagger that is a bit of an insufferable prick serves him well on stage, and it suits the songs that he and Keith Richards have written over their many tears as writing partners. There's a kind of FU nonchalence to his strutting coq, shameless and horny, like the eponymous little red rooster he sings about in one of their signature songs. It wouldn't be right if he sounded like he'd had singing lessons.
